- Spotlight On: Samaritan’s Purse Samaritan’s Purse is a nondenominational evangelical Christian organization providing spiritual and physical aid to hurting people around the world. Since 1970, this organization has helped meet the needs of people who are victims of war, poverty, natural disasters, disease and famine with the purpose of sharing God’s love through His Son, Jesus Christ. - Spotlight On: Agape International Mission Agape International Mission (AIM) began in 1988 in Cambodia as a humanitarian aid organization. Since 2005, AIM’s main purpose has been to eradicate the evil of child sex slavery. - Spotlight On: Men of Valor Men of Valor’s mission is to win men in prison to Christ and disciple them. Their purpose is to equip them to re-enter society as men of integrity — becoming givers to the community rather than takers.
